Advanced Tips: Understanding AFM/DFM on GM Vehicles

Advanced engine diagnostics reveal that maintaining 100 percent cylinder activation reduces lateral stress on the crankshaft and prevents carbon buildup on inactive intake valves, which is a common cause of internal 6.2L engine damage.

General Motors introduced Active Fuel Management and later Dynamic Fuel Management to meet federal fuel economy standards. However, the mechanical cost of these systems is high for the individual truck owner. The 6.2L engine utilizes high pressure oiling systems to collapse specific lifters, effectively turning the engine into a four cylinder during low load situations. This process creates an imbalance in heat and lubrication. Over time, the constant mechanical movement of the locking pins inside the lifters leads to failure. When a lifter fails, it often destroys the camshaft, necessitating a total engine tear down. Understanding these mechanics is vital for anyone planning a Chevy 6.2 engine replacement because installing a new engine without addressing the management system simply restarts the countdown to the next failure. How Cylinder Deactivation Causes Lifter Failure

The constant switching between V4 and V8 modes creates uneven wear on the active lifters and can lead to oil aeration. Over time, this leads to premature lifter failure, bent pushrods, and costly engine rebuilds that can exceed five thousand dollars. The mechanical stress is most prevalent during the transition phase where the ECU must perfectly timing the oil pressure spike to engage or disengage the lifter pins. If the timing is off by milliseconds due to oil viscosity changes or debris, the pin can partially engage, leading to a catastrophic collapse. This is why many 6.2L owners hear a ticking sound before the engine eventually fails completely. Maintaining V8 mode keeps the oil pressure consistent across the entire valvetrain.
